To illustrate this, let A = 3 and B = 5. … WebExample: Solve the expression: $6$ $(20 + 5)$ using the distributive property of multiplication over addition. Let’s use the property to calculate the expression $6$ $(20 + 5)$, the number 6 is spread across the two addends. To put it simply, we multiply each addend by 6 and then the products can be added. $6 20 + 6 5 = 120 + 30 = 150$
